Early results from hydraulic fracturing study show no direct link to groundwater contamination

Thursday, November 10, 2011 - 08:01 in Earth & Climate

Preliminary findings from a study on the use of hydraulic fracturing in shale gas development suggest no direct link to reports of groundwater contamination, the project leader at The University of Texas at Austin’s Energy Institute said Wednesday.
